Hello, i bought a frag of goldenrod anacro a couple of months ago. It is growing ok and seems happy but the color is rather greenish and not really yellow. No matter the light spectrum. Is there any reason? Not true goldenrod? Thanks.

200 pars - i thought it was enough for anacropora to thrive.
 
Is it same coral? Mine get more yellow whenever nutrient stay around NO3 10 and PO4 0.1

200 pars - i thought it was enough for anacropora to thrive.
Not really, some SPS will do ok there but others won't and coloring may be a factor of that. I have mine at 350 par near the top and some growing in around 250 to 300 mid tank.
